FCTA To Celebrate FCT@50 During Tinubu Administration’s 3rd Anniversary – Wike

Minister of the Federal Capital Territory (FCT), Nyesom Wike, has said the FCT Administration (FCTA) will celebrate FCT at 50 during the third anniversary of President Bola Tinubu administration.

Wike disclosed this in Abuja on Wednesday during a meeting with members of staff of the FCT Administration as part of activities to celebrate the Territory’s golden jubilee.

He said that a committee would soon be inaugurated to plan the FCT golden jubilee and Tinubu’s third anniversary in office.

The minister, who thanked God that FCT clocked 50 years during his time as minister, said that a compendium for the golden jubilee would be unveiled during the celebration in three months time.

He said that the transformation in the FCT and other achievements recorded in the last two and a half years wouldn’t have been possible if not for the support of Tinubu.

He argued that infrastructural development in the FCT was slow until Tinubu removed the administration from the Treasury Single Account (TSA), which enabled access to funding to execute life-impacting projects across the territory.

“Every time we say, for years, no infrastructure. Why would there be infrastructure when there’s something restraining you, but removing FCT from TSA allows the administration to access funding from commercial banks.

“Today, everybody is saying there’s massive infrastructural development. If that was not made possible, we would still be hanging around; we would still be saying nothing is going on.

“So, we must appreciate somebody who has laid the foundation for us to get to where we are,” he said.

He pointed out that beyond infrastructural transformation, workers of the FCT Administration had equally recorded a milestone under Tinubu, particularly in career progression to Permanent Secretaries or Head of FCT Civil Service.

“Ministers have come and gone; presidents have come and gone but no one made this possible except Tinubu.

“Today, every worker is happy that there’s hope that they can be a permanent secretary. There’s hope they can be a head of service.

“This is not easy to achieve but somebody made it possible,” Wike said.

Earlier, Mr Richard Dauda, the acting Executive Secretary, Federal Capital Development Authority (FCDA), said that the level of achievements recorded within the last two and half years in infrastructural development was unprecedented in the 50-year history of the FCT and the FCDA.

He said that at the inception of the current FCT Administration in August 2023, a number of projects were inherited from previous administrations.

“Many of these projects have now been completed and inaugurated while the remaining few have been taken to an appreciable level of completion.

“This is as a result of the commitment, dedication and proactive drive of the leadership of the current Administration under Wike,” he said.

He said that Wike had inaugurated about nine projects during the first-year anniversary of Tinubu in 2024 and 17 projects in 2025 during the second-year anniversary.

Dauda expressed confidence that with the number of ongoing projects being planned for inauguration to mark Tinubu’s third anniversary, “it is likely to hit 50 projects inaugurated since Wike assumed duty as FCT Minister in August 2023.″
